Reading This Comparison

Size is not the same as rate

Totals and per-capita measures answer different questions. A country can have a far larger economy and a far lower GDP per capita at the same time — both facts are in the table.

Mind the vintages

Each value is the latest available for that country, which is not always the same year on both sides. For indicators that move slowly this rarely matters; for inflation or GDP growth it can.
